Crypto has been on many lawmakers’ lips in the last six days following Russia’s military efforts in Ukraine.
Economy and finance ministers representing nations in the European Union have said they will address Russia’s potential use of cryptocurrencies to evade sanctions imposed on it following its operations in Ukraine.
Speaking to reporters through an interpreter following an informal video conference of EU economy and finance ministers on Wednesday, France’s finance minister, Bruno Le Maire,lawmakers had already worked to freeze “a significant amount of the assets” in Russia’s central bank as part of its efforts to financially penalize the country over its ongoing efforts in Ukraine.
“We are taking measures, in particular on cryptocurrencies or crypto assets, which should not be used to circumvent the financial sanctions,” said Le Maire. “We will be taking stock on a daily basis with regard to the implementation of these sanctions, their effectiveness and any additional measures which may be needed. When it comes to economic and financial sanctions, we want to remain flexible and mobilized.
